Description

Hot-press solidifying device
Technical field
The utility model relates to LCDs processing technique field, is specifically a kind of hot-press solidifying device.
Background technology
Field is manufactured in LCDs, irrigation crystal is generally be filled between two blocks of glass, these two blocks of glass treat that the frame of irrigation crystal scope is generally adopt bonding agent to seal, adopt the mode of hot-press solidifying that the bonding agent between two blocks of glass is solidified at present, in prior art, generally adopt pressing plate by after display screen pressing when carrying out hot-press solidifying, put into baking box to toast, after the time reaching solidification, naturally cool again, then the glass plate be cured is taken out, then carry out the operations such as follow-up irrigation crystal, sliver.
Adopt in this way, heat in an oven, after reaching the solidification temperature of setting, then after the set time of setting, stop heating, and then to cool, to be cooled to natural temperature time, take out workpiece again, the time spent by above-mentioned operation is oversize, and production efficiency is too low.

Embodiment
Below in conjunction with the drawings and specific embodiments, the utility model is described in further detail:
As shown in Figure 1-Figure 3, the utility model proposes a kind of hot-press solidifying device, it comprises press, top board 1, lower platen 2, tank for coolant and hot pressing liquid case;
Press and top board 1 or lower platen 2 connect and carry out pressing for controlling top board 1 with lower platen 2 or be separated; Generally, press is all be connected with top board, controls that top board does to the action pressed down.Press is prior art, can adopt fluid power or the various ways such as pneumatic or electronic, press this as prior art, therefore do not describe in detail at this.
The lower surface of top board 1 is provided with the peripheral sealing of the first liquid capsule 3, first liquid capsule 3 that flexible material makes and top board 1; Described first liquid capsule 3 is generally silica gel or elastomeric material is made, and in the present embodiment, the first liquid capsule 3 is laid on the lower surface of top board 1, and the peripheral sealing of the first liquid capsule 3 and top board 1,
Described tank for coolant is communicated with by the inner space of pipeline with the first liquid capsule 3, and described hot pressing liquid case is communicated with by the inside pipe fitting of pipeline with the first liquid capsule 3;
First passage 5 is provided with in described top board 1, the lower surface that the outs open of first passage 5 is located at top board 1 is used for being communicated with the first liquid capsule 3, as shown in Figure 3, first passage 5 is provided with multiple opening at the lower surface of top board 1, the cold oil coming from deep fat in hot pressing liquid case and tank for coolant can enter into the first liquid capsule 3 by first passage 5, the outside surface that other opening of first passage 5 is located at top board is used for being connected with pipeline, and the inner space of pipeline with the first liquid capsule is communicated with by described first passage.Described first passage 5 is many in the present embodiment, the outside surface opening of some first passage and the input duct of hot pressing liquid case and fluid pipeline communication, the opening of the outside surface of another part first passage and the input duct of tank for coolant and fluid pipeline communication.
After adopting aforesaid way, during work, to treat that the workpiece of hot-press solidifying is put on lower platen, then deep fat case is opened, deep fat is full of the first liquid capsule, the temperature of the deep fat adopted in the present embodiment is 180 degrees Celsius, then control press and carry out pressing, treat after the time of hot-press solidifying, open tank for coolant, cold oil in tank for coolant is full of the first liquid capsule, deep fat originally in the first liquid capsule is got back in hot pressing liquid case through the flowline of hot pressing liquid case, can cool soon like this, and then top board is separated with lower platen, take out workpiece, then next workpiece is put into, deep fat is filled into the first liquid capsule again, cold oil conveying is got back in tank for coolant, carry out pressing again, and go on successively.
Can find out compared with baking box next, the said structure heat time is fast, and cool time is fast, and simple to operation, and efficiency can improve greatly.
The upper surface of described lower platen is provided with the second liquid capsule that flexible material is made, the peripheral sealing of described second liquid capsule and lower platen;
Described tank for coolant is communicated with by the inner space of pipeline with the second liquid capsule, and described hot pressing liquid case is communicated with by the inside pipe fitting of pipeline with the second liquid capsule;
Second channel is provided with in described lower platen, the upper surface that the outs open of second channel is located at lower platen is used for being communicated with the second liquid capsule, the outside surface that other opening of second channel is located at lower platen is used for being connected with pipeline, and the inner space of pipeline with the second liquid capsule is communicated with by described second channel.Adopt this structure that heating fluid capsule is also set on lower platen, the upper and lower surface of workpiece can be heated, be heated more even, hot-press solidifying better effects if.
Second channel in lower platen is identical with the structure of the first passage in top board, does not therefore draw in the drawings.
Described hot-press solidifying device also comprises controller, and described controller is connected with the control device of tank for coolant, hot pressing liquid case and press, is used for controlled cooling model liquid, the flowing of hot pressing liquid and the action of press.Adopt in this way, the liquid flow in overall controlled cooling model liquid case and hot pressing liquid case can be carried out by controller, and control the action of press, operate more simple and convenient.
In described tank for coolant, cold oil is housed, in described hot pressing liquid case, deep fat is housed.Cold oil and deep fat is adopted to cool and heat, better effects if.Described tank for coolant is also provided with cooling device, adopts mode tank for coolant being put into frozen water machine in the present embodiment, the cold oil returned can be lowered the temperature again, reuse from liquid capsule.
Described first passage is provided with multiple at the opening of the lower surface of top board, and is uniformly distributed.Adopt this structure, can quickly deep fat or cold oil be poured in liquid capsule.
Described pipeline adopts flexible pipe.Because top board is the action needing to do pressing and separation, adopt flexible pipe convenient.
